About Boštjan Murovec
Boštjan Murovec is a scholar working on Molecular Biology, Physiology, Computer Vision and Pattern Recognition, Ecology and Electrical and Electronic Engineering, having authored 22 papers that have together received 277 indexed citations. Recurring topics across this work include Gut microbiota and health (7 papers), Metabolomics and Mass Spectrometry Studies (7 papers), Diet and metabolism studies (4 papers), Genomics and Phylogenetic Studies (4 papers), Microbial Community Ecology and Physiology (3 papers), Robotic Path Planning Algorithms (2 papers), Scheduling and Optimization Algorithms (2 papers) and Assembly Line Balancing Optimization (2 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(24 citations), Pollution (22 citations), Physiology (44 citations), Ecology (45 citations) and Molecular Biology (111 citations). Boštjan Murovec has collaborated with scholars based in Slovenia, United States and Sweden. Frequent co-authors include Blaž Stres, James M. Tiedje, Woo Jun Sul, Robert Šket, Tadej Debevec, Igor B. Mekjavić, Michael Schloter, Janez Plavec, Ola Eiken and Susanne Kublik. Their work appears in journals such as PLoS ONE, Frontiers in Physiology, Frontiers in Microbiology, European Journal of Operational Research and Energy Reports.
